What signals should I have at the Trans plug?
Going into the Trans what signal should be at the plug.
Example: if i unplug the Trans and check the top left wire on the plug, (harness side)(plug facing me) what should the signal be? +/- nothing And the same for the rest of the wires. also if the trans is in gear (and pluged in)what signal should be cominig out of the Trans when?

Going by wire color, tan/black is lockup(pin D), purple is +12V feed(pin A), dk grn/white is 3rd gear switch(pin C), light blue is 4th gear switch(pin B).

Is this how it works? 1- The computer feeds tan/black -/ground to activate the L/U 2- Purple is always live +12V to the L/U solenoid 3- 3rd gear switch Dk grn/white feeds the computer Ground when the Trans is in 3rd gear. 4-4th gear switch Lt blue feeds the computer Ground when the Trans is in 4th gear. Did I get this right? Does the computer know when the car is in 1st or 2nd? If so How?

That's pretty much it, ECM uses the park/neutral switch to know it's in gear and if the 3rd or 4th gear switches aren't activated it assumes 1st or 2nd gear(doesn't make a difference to ECM whether 1st or 2nd).
